We stumbled across this gem while traveling down the coast from our visit to Acadia National Park. My husband has a weakness for hotdogs so even though we’d had a hearty breakfast, we made the room to stop for a good ol’ fashioned wiener.

Because we are Millennial/Gen Z cusp babies, we rarely carry cash, so we were scared we might lose our opportunity for this American classic when we saw it was cash-only. Thankfully, there were two ATMs in the parking lot and we were able to withdraw a crisp $20 to try a few of the items here.

As we approached the stand, we were delighted to see the setup of the interior. One worker manning a grill and handling the drive-thru orders, and one worker manning a grill for the walk-up orders. Each grill was plentiful with hot dogs approaching the perfect char and the smell carried outside of the stand awakened the taste buds. The lovely young woman running the walk-up side was friendly and prompt, giving us our order at practically the same time she passed us our change.

We ordered a plain cheeseburger, one wiener with ketchup, one Chili Cheese dog, and one Western Dog to sample a few different options! The Chili Cheese Dog was that classic flavor with the perfect balance of flavors and enough of each ingredient to have a perfect bite every time without getting messy. The Western Dog was a unique mix of flavors outside of the standard, but still simple enough to appeal to my picky husband, who typically prefers his wiener with ketchup only.

We were very pleased with our visit and glad that our time driving through coincided with their limited hours. Quick, great service, great food, and great prices! It’s just too bad that we don’t have one of these back home.

Sometimes, you just need a hot dog to do the trick!

Driving back down to Portland after visiting Acadia National Park, I got hungry on the road and looked for a quick bite to eat. When I opened up my maps, I saw this hotdog stand and was intrigued by all of the positive reviews.

Located in a parking lot, it was nothing spectacular from its appearance, but the service was extremely fast and friendly, and the hotdog was surprisingly delicious.

I ordered an everything dog which came with grilled onions, mustard, and relish on what I am assuming is a unique Maine-style bun (aka not a typical hot dog bun I am used to).

The price was fair and the hotdog was ample. After my first bite, I knew why people enjoyed these hot dogs so much. Nothing fancy, but just a good classic hotdog.

The BEST hot dogs and two people can have lunch for $15!! My wife gets mustard and raw onions...pretty basic. I get them with everything, which is sauces onions, mustard, and relish. You can choose spicy relish or plain. I like the spicy. Not too hot, but has a kick. Our favorite quick lunch! We go to all three locations...Belfast, Thomaston , and Rockland. Belfast has a large lot to park and eat or picnic tables to sit at.
